Common Aspect Ratios
| Ratio | Use Case |
|---|---|
| 16:9 | Widescreen monitors, YouTube, HDTV |
| 4:3 | Classic TV, iPad, presentations |
| 21:9 | Ultrawide monitors, cinema |
| 1:1 | Instagram square posts |
| 9:16 | Mobile stories, TikTok, Reels |
| 3:2 | DSLR photography, MacBook displays |

What is an aspect ratio?
An aspect ratio is the proportional relationship between width and height. For example, 16:9 means for every 16 units of width, there are 9 units of height.
